Clad Steel Plate From Japan

Determination

    On the basis of the record \1\ developed in the subject five-year 
review, the United States International Trade Commission 
(``Commission'') determines, pursuant to the Tariff Act of 1930 (``the 
Act''), that revocation of the

[[Page 63905]]

antidumping duty order on clad steel plate from Japan would be likely 
to lead to continuation or recurrence of material injury to an industry 
in the United States within a reasonably foreseeable time.

Background

    The Commission, pursuant to section 751(c) of the Act (19 U.S.C. 
1675(c)), instituted this review on January 2, 2018 (83 FR 148) and 
determined on April 9, 2018 that it would conduct a full review (83 FR 
17446, April 19, 2018). Notice of the scheduling of the Commission's 
review and of a public hearing to be held in connection therewith was 
given by posting copies of the notice in the Office of the Secretary, 
U.S. International Trade Commission, Washington, DC, and by publishing 
the notice in the Federal Register on July 17, 2018 (83 FR 33250). The 
Commission cancelled the hearing scheduled on October 18, 2018 
following a request by the sole party to the proceeding (83 FR 53295, 
October 22, 2018). In lieu of a hearing, the domestic producers 
responded to written questions submitted by the Commission, as part of 
their post-hearing brief.
    The Commission made this determination pursuant to section 751(c) 
of the Act (19 U.S.C. 1675 (c)). It completed and filed its 
determination in this review on December 6, 2018. The views of the 
Commission are contained in USITC Publication 4851 (December 2018), 
entitled Clad Steel Plate from Japan: Investigation No. 731-TA-739 
(Fourth Review).
